TEAPOT and SUGAR BOWL set, porcelain, handpainted by Mary Ann Craigie

H2016.23.1-4

TEAPOT & SUGAR BOWL, iridescent white, moulded porcelain, with West Australian Wildflowers painted on them.
[.1] TEAPOT, body of the teapot is handpainted with yellow Nuytsia floribunda and leaves (Western Australian Christmas Tree) spilling down both sides of bowl, the handle and tip of spout are painted gold. The body has ten facets around it, which is pale blue and pink. The underside has 'M. CRAIGIE/1931./CHRISTMAS. BUSH./ W.A.' handpainted in grey. 'VICTORIA/ Czecho-Slovakia' with logo stamped in green to underside.
[.2]TEAPOT LID, fitted matching pink lid with sculpted, gold, acorn-shaped handle. A lip secures the lid to the pot and a small steam hole is drilled through the lid.
[.3] SUGAR BOWL, matching pink and grey with similar ten facets, two curved handles each one painted gold. Hand painted clematis flowers and leaves spill down each side of the bowl. The base has 'M.CRAIGIE/1931/ CLEMATIS/W.A.' handwritten in grey and the manufacturers logo and 'VICTORIA/CZECHO-SLOVAKIA' stamped on it
[.4] SUGAR BOWL LID, fitted lid with acorn-shaped handle, painted gold atop on matching pink surface of lid
